Please join us on Wednesday, September 28 at 11:00am EST, for Core Session 3: Blueprint for Talent Development. This is part of the U.S. Department of Labor, Employment and Training Administration's Fall Three-Day Sector Strategies Virtual Business Engagement Academy on September 26-28, 2016.

Description

Full publication title: Sector Strategies Virtual Institute Business Engagement Academy Core Session 3: Blueprint for Talent Development

Through expert facilitation, audience members will take a deeper dive from Core Session 1, to share suggestions for how they would approach what they heard from employers during the model industry meeting (Opening Session), and actual solutions/changes/initiatives they would launch. There will be a brief overview and recap from the first two sessions, a discussion with 2 health care industry focused intermediaries, and breakout rooms for audience members to present their proposed solutions.
